[Bug 1795216] [NEW] Hide empty panel in Xubuntu

Xubuntu 18.04+ does not ship with indicator-applicaton (needed for nm-
applet) or indicator-sound anymore, and this results in having an empty
panel with no indicators at top of the installer screen.

The panel could be hidden by reverting the following commit:
https://git.launchpad.net/ubiquity/commit/?id=f8356ea277efc8dded2bc7057e6e161383f73884
